MR67 Mayera Rapaporta is a 4-star aparthotel nestled near Wawel Royal Castle, with an impressive 95% excellent rating on TripAdvisor. Just a 10-minute stroll from the Old Town's Medieval square, it's an ideal base for exploring Kazimierz, the historic Jewish quarter, known for its synagogues and trendy bars. Be sure to visit Mleczarnia, a charming former Jewish milk bar featuring sepia photos, antique candelabras, and a tree-shaded garden. Enjoy complimentary Wi-Fi during your stay.
The property provides accommodation in one of 47 newly decorated rooms. Guest rooms on the property are equipped with a flat-screen TV, free wi-fi, minibar, safety deposit, kettle, ironing set, tea, coffee, a bottle of water. All rooms have air conditioning and some of them have a balcony, separate bedroom, dining area or sky view. Bathrooms are with walk-in shower or bathtub, however, each is equipped with a hairdryer, towels and toiletries.
MR67 Mayera Rapaporta provides accommodation with free wifi, air-condition, touristic information, assistance with tours organisation.
Guests at the accommodation can enjoy a buffet breakfast served between 7 AM and 12 PM.
